Strategically located, the Camellia House is only 10 mins. away from both Parris Island and downtown, offering simple access to all the attractions Beaufort has to offer. Yet, it provides a relaxing getaway for private family moments.
Explore close by gems such as the enchanting Spanish Moss Trail and the pristine Hunting Island Beaches, or create lasting memories at home. The game-room is ideal for family fun, ensuring everybody can relax and appreciate their favorite games.

About the Area
Mossy Oaks, a neighborhood in Beaufort, is home to this vacation home. The area's natural beauty can be seen at Westvine Drive Trailhead and Cypress Wetlands, while USCB Center for the Arts and Beaufort Museum are cultural highlights.
